It was founded in 2013 by brothers Ivan and Tomislav Dijaković.[2] In 2016 they were voted the best MMA Gym in Germany by the German martial arts portal GNP1.de.[3] In 2017 UFD Gym was voted as "the best gym of the year in Germany" by the German web portal GFN (German Fight News).[4]
